Skilled Team for New Project
Ladbrokes and Canal+ previously announced plans for a joint venture into the
French online casino gambling industry that is now really starting to take
shape. Both of the companies are eager to use their license to launch into the
newly opened French market and take a share of the waiting market. Both
companies have a strong reputation in the marketplace for excellence and their
new joint site is an anticipated success. The latest development toward
launching the new company is the setting of the management team. Both companies
have contributed some of their top talent to the new company and the management
team for the new online casino gambling site has decades of experience and
success within the gambling industry.
The two central members of the new company are François Deplanck in the role of
CEO and Mick D’Ancona as the COO. Deplanck brings to the management team
experience within the French market, though not necessarily the online casinos
because this is really the first liberalization of the market and the first time
that the French government is welcoming a relatively competitive internet
gambling market. D’Ancona on the other hand has experience with Ladbrokes as the
former head of the IT department and remote gambling operations for Ladbrokes.
These two have the joint expertise for a successful online casino gambling
operation, but are also joined by a handful of other highly skilled board
members.
Although Ladbrokes is working with Canal+ to launch this new joint online casino
and internet gambling venture, Ladbrokes has publicly noted that the company
will not launch any other French gaming sites while the venture with Canal+ is
in operation. At this point this aspect of the deal is not a major sticking
point because of all of the severe taxes that offshore companies face for
operating within the French market without a link to a French based company. |
